WebbMany touchpads use two-finger dragging for scrolling. Also, some touchpad drivers support tap zones, regions where a tap will execute a function, for example, pausing a media player or launching an application. All of these functions are implemented in the touchpad device driver software, and can be disabled. History [ edit]

WebbFor example if you wish to enable Tapping and disable Natural Scrolling for your user, adjust the touchpad key-values like the following: $ gsettings set org.gnome.desktop.peripherals.touchpad tap-to-click true $ gsettings set org.gnome.desktop.peripherals.touchpad natural-scroll false Inertial scrolling does not … Webb21 juni 2024 · Reset your touchpad: If you don’t like the settings you selected, simply reset the touchpad to start over. On Windows 10, scroll down to the bottom of the page and then select Reset. On Windows 11, select Touchpad at the top of the screen, and then select Reset next to "Reset touchpad settings and gestures to defaults."
